Getting Ready For LASIK Eye Surgery



Before you go through LASIK eye surgical procedure, it's essential to prepare effectively so you can make certain the best feasible outcome.

Start by arranging a thorough eye exam to identify if you're an ideal candidate. Discuss your medical history and any type of medications you're taking with your optometrist. You'll require to stop wearing call lenses for a certain duration before the test, as they can affect the shape of your cornea.



Arrange for a person to drive you home after the treatment, as you will not have the ability to see plainly immediately later. In addition, think about stockpiling any essential drugs and eye drops your doctor recommends for post-surgery care.

Complying with these actions will certainly help you feel confident and ready for your LASIK experience.

The LASIK Procedure Explained



During the LASIK treatment, you'll experience a series of specific actions developed to reshape your cornea and enhance your vision.

Initially, you'll lie down in a comfortable chair, and the doctor will apply numbing decreases to your eyes.

Then, a device will gently hold your eyelids available to protect against blinking.

Next off, the cosmetic surgeon uses a microkeratome or femtosecond laser to develop a slim flap in the cornea.

After raising the flap, a laser reshapes the underlying corneal cells based on your particular prescription.

Once that's done, the flap is rearranged, sealing itself without stitches.

The whole procedure commonly takes about 15 mins per eye.

You may really feel some stress, however it's normally pain-free.

Post-Operative Care and Recuperation



After your LASIK surgery, it's essential to follow particular post-operative treatment guidelines to make certain a smooth recovery and optimum outcomes.

You'll likely experience some discomfort, such as dryness or blurry vision, so use the prescribed eye drops to maintain your eyes moist. Avoid massaging  Get the facts  and wear safety goggles while resting to prevent injury.

It's likewise vital to restrict display time and bright light exposure for the first few days. Attend follow-up consultations to check your recovery progress.

If you see any kind of unusual signs and symptoms, like serious pain or vision modifications, contact your doctor right away.
